    5 Queue-Beating Strategies

    1. Book Louvre time slots on the official website (free reservation, just create an account) — more availability than third-party platforms
    2. Eiffel Tower summit tickets: official website drops 2 months ahead — Tiqets/Klook skip-the-line tickets available 2-3 weeks ahead
    3. Versailles afternoon entry (after 3 PM) — visitor numbers drop 40%, fountain shows (Musical Fountains Show, +€12) look better in afternoon light
    4. Buy Paris Museum Pass (2/4/6 days) if visiting 5+ museums — €65 for 4 days vs. €74 buying individually (Louvre €22 + Orsay €16 + Versailles €22 + Invalides €14), saves ~12%
    5. Use Tiqets skip-the-line tickets for attractions where you couldn’t secure official timed entry

    Q: Is the Paris Museum Pass worth it? A: If visiting 5+ museums, the 4-day pass at €65 saves approximately 12% vs. individual tickets (Louvre €22 + Orsay €16 + Versailles €22 + Invalides €14 = €74). However, it does not include Eiffel Tower or Versailles skip-the-line access — purchase those separately.

    Q: How hot does Paris get in summer? A: Paris summer temperatures average 18-25°C. Mornings and evenings are cool, afternoons can be warm with strong UV. Bring a light jacket (museums have strong AC), sunscreen, and a sun hat. Rain occurs ~30% of days — pack a compact umbrella.

    Q: Is Paris safe? Which areas should I avoid? A: Pickpocketing is common near major attractions (Eiffel Tower, Champs-Élysées, Louvre entrance), particularly by organized youth groups. Recommendations: separate ID from credit cards, carry bags in front, avoid displaying valuables. Emergency number: 17 (police).
